Exegesis

The clause ki-malakh {כִּֽי־מַלְאַךְ | kī-malʾā́ḵ}, the divine name YHWH {יְהוָה | Yə-hō-wāh}, and the pronoun hu {הוּא | hū} assert definitive identity. The formal maintains Hebrew structure and technical terms, while the dynamic smooths the sequence and emphasizes cognitive realization.

In contextJudges 13:21

And the angel of the LORD did not appear again to Manoah or to his wife; then Manoah realized that it was the angel of the LORD.

About this coordinate

Judges 13:21:3 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 3 of Judges 13:21, so the Hebrew word מַלְאַ֣ךְ (malakh)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written Judg.13.21.W3, which extends further down to each syllable (Judg.13.21.W3.S1) and character.
